Case: 4929

Breaking and Entering

Cambridge Athletic Club - Cambridge
Date of Crime: October 27, 2011

Victim reports gym locker break and bank cards stolen while working out. Within an hour, unauthorized purchases and attempts were made in Cambridge, Boston and Revere. The three males depicted on video surveillance footage were observed conducting these unauthorized transactions.

Special thanks to Revere Det. Romboli and Boston PD Officer Fornash for the suspect identifications of: Greg Cabral, Lawrence Parker, and Kyle Silva. Arrest have been made and complaints have been issued. .
